Las Vigas de Ramírez

Las Vigas de Ramírez is a city in the Mexican state of Veracruz.

The city was established by decree on 23 November 1523, named after the teacher Rafael Ramírez Castañeda [es] (1884–1959).

[2][3] It is located 40 km from the state capital, Xalapa; it stands on the Mexico City to Veracruz railway and on Federal Highways 180 and 122.

[4] Las Vigas de Ramírez, the municipal seat, it's the only considered urban with a population of 9,924 inhabitants.

[4] Major agricultural products include corn, coffee, fruits, and rice.
